Jumpmasters/Facilitators
Within skydiving, jumpmasters are the people who facilitate the
students’ leap from an airplane. Meet the jumpmasters from the Jump
Institute: facilitators for this training with a diverse level of
experience as successful business professionals and World Champion
athletes! The JUMP Team is led by national speaker, writer, trainer and
former U.S. Army Ranger, David Hart. A graduate of the University of
Cincinnati, David combines his jump experience with a solid grounding in
business, having accumulated more than 15 years of experience in sales,
management and marketing, including over five years as founder and CEO
of a national retail/amusement company. He is the author of “JUMP! Leaps
in Organizational Performance and Teamwork.”
